General Role Description:

As a Licensed Clinical Therapist / Independent Licensed Therapist , you will treat a wide variety of mental health conditions that reflect the needs of our diverse patient population . 

Primary Responsibilities:

 

  • Form excellent provider-patient alliances and coordinate care with external providers
  • Screen and assess patients for common mental health 
  • Provide treatment for a variety of mental health conditions using treatment approaches including cognitive behavioral therapy, dialectical behavioral therapy, and other evidence-based methods
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date electronic medical records (Athena) and clinical documentation, ensuring compliance with all regulatory requirements

 

 

Competency Requirements:

 

· Master’s degree in psychology, social work, or a related counseling field

· Must have a clear, active and unrestricted license (LCSW, LMFT, or LPC ) in Pennsylvania

 

Preferred Qualifications:

 

·2.0+ years professional social work / clinical experience post Master's degree

· Experience providing direct psychotherapy services to individuals and families

· Experience working with computers for professional communication and medical documentation - Excel, Outlook, Athena RMS (or other EHRs)

· Ability to work both independently and collaboratively with equal effectiveness
